WebIf your dog accidentally eats a falafel, he should be fine. Monitor him over the next hours for signs and symptoms of digestive distress. If anything is noticed, call your veterinarian for … WebMost dogs do not tolerate pepper well and could experience digestive issues. Fat. Falafel is a fried dish and dogs should avoid fried foods. A normal serving has roughly 17.5 grams of fat, which is more than a 30 pound dog should have in a day. Fatty food can lead to weight gain and health issues in your dog. WebMay 6, 2024 · Mold into small balls and place on cookie sheet. Place cookie sheet in the freezer and allow falafel to freeze until slightly frozen, about an hour so. Remove cookie sheet from freezer and quickly place falafel balls into a freezer-safe bag or container. Place back into the freezer. Frozen uncooked falafel should last about 6 months in the freezer.
